Renowned for its transformative effects, rosehip oil is a gem in natural skincare. Derived from the seeds of the wild Rosa rubiginosa shrub, this natural elixir has been used for centuries for its remarkable ability to hydrate and heal the skin. Packed with essential nutrients, rosehip oil offers an array of benefits that make it a must-have in any daily skincare routine. Whether you're tackling dullness or fine lines, here is an in-depth exploration of the numerous skincare benefits of rosehip oil.

Dense With in Vitamins and Antioxidants

Rosehip oil is a powerhouse of vitamins, particularly vitamin A (in the form of natural retinoids) and vitamin C.

These nutrients are crucial for skin health:

• Vitamin A: Natural retinoids in vitamin A help refresh skin texture and tone. It also supports a balanced skin tone while boosting radiance.

• Vitamin C: It shields the skin while promoting a firmer and more radiant appearance. It also guards against UV-related skin damage.

The oil’s high antioxidant content combats oxidative stress, which can lead to premature aging. By incorporating rosehip oil into your routine, you can shield your skin from the harmful effects of UV rays and pollution.

Intense Nutrients and Moisturization

A remarkable feature of rosehip oil is its deep hydration capabilities. Rich in essential fatty acids such as linoleic acid and oleic acid, it provides long-lasting moisture while reinforcing the skin barrier. This makes it an excellent choice for those with fragile or moisture-starved skin. Unlike heavier oils, rosehip oil is fast-absorbing and perfect for all skin textures, ensuring compatibility with blemish-prone complexions.

Minimizes Signs of Aging

The anti-aging effects of rosehip oil make it a standout skincare ingredient. Its natural retinoids encourage collagen production and skin cell renewal, which reduce visible signs of aging such as wrinkles and fine lines. The antioxidants in rosehip oil also support the skin’s defense against environmental aging factors. Over time, the complexion becomes visibly firm and refreshed.

Enhances Complexion and Minimizes Hyperpigmentation

Dark spots and uneven tone are common skin concerns for many. Rosehip oil contains compounds such as skin-tone-enhancing nutrients like carotenoids, which fade visible marks and enhance skin clarity. Its natural retinoids encourage the shedding of pigmented skin cells, promoting a more even complexion. Additionally, the vitamin C content brightens areas of concern and boosts radiance.
